Electric steps (e-steps) are a popular choice for urban commuters and thrill-seekers alike. To ensure your e-step stays in top shape, regular maintenance is key. Here are some tips to keep your ride smooth and safe.
1. Check Tire Pressure Underinflated tires can reduce efficiency and wear out faster. Check your tire pressure regularly and keep it at the manufacturer’s recommended level.
2. Keep the Battery Healthy Avoid fully depleting your battery and charge it after every ride. Store your e-step in a cool, dry place to prevent battery degradation.
3. Inspect Brakes Effective brakes are crucial for safety. Test them before each ride and replace brake pads or discs as needed.
4. Clean Your E-Step Dirt and debris can affect performance. Wipe down your e-step with a damp cloth, avoiding direct water exposure to the electrical components.
5. Schedule Professional Check-Ups Take your e-step to a professional technician for periodic check-ups. They can identify and fix any hidden issues before they become major problems.
By following these tips, you’ll maximize your e-step’s lifespan and enjoy a reliable, efficient ride for years to come.
